6. My Country 2 Things That Represent My Country 1 Given below are a few things that represent our country, India. This is my country, India. Tricolour Lotus This is our This is our National Flag. National Flower. Tiger Peacock This is our This is our National Animal. National Bird. 80

2 National Flag Let us learn about our National Flag. Our National Flag is called The Tricolour. It has three coloured bands. They are saffron, white and green. The flag has a blue coloured wheel in the centre, called Ashoka Chakra. It has 24 spokes in it. Saffron White Green Wheel 81

8. Healthy Food 2 My Healthy Plate 1 A healthy meal has all types of food like grains, vegetables, fruits, fats and oils, milk and dairy products, meat, beans, fish and nuts. Dal Rice Milk Vegetables Curd Nuts Roti Chicken Fish 86

2 What I Must Eat Give you energy. Rice, Chapati, Dosa, Idli and Bread Help you grow and make your muscles stronger. Dal, Chana, Meat, Fish, Eggs, Milk and Yoghurt Make you sharper and stronger from inside. Carrots, Cabbage, Tomatoes, Spinach, Brinjal, Apple, Mango, Bananas 87

The Capseller and the Monkeys Once there was a cap seller. He had many caps in the basket to sell. One day, he was very tired. He lay down to sleep under a tree. While he slept, the monkeys on the tree took all his caps. When he woke up, the cap seller was shocked. Then, he had an idea. 94

He threw his cap down. The monkeys threw their caps down too. The clever cap seller took all his caps and went away. 95
